DAQ is short hand for data acquisition. Simply stated, it is a combination of
measurement and control functions integrated into a signal DAQ board or card. A
DAQ system is not just the “acquisition” of data, but rather, it is both the
“acquisition” and “control” of data, both in analog and digital form.
A DAQ system can convert analog signals into a digital output form, which can be
manipulated with software. Using software in conjunction with a personal
computer, analog data can be displayed, logged, charted, graphed, or stored in
memory as needed.
Stored data can later be used and compared with a set of established limits.
Control decisions are made if the stored data is at the limit, above or below
the limit. With repetitive measurement made by a data acquisition system, continues
monitoring and control can be performed.
Based on matching, meeting or exceed the set limits, a digital control signal
(in the form of single bit output signal) can be used to turn on or turn of a
relay. This in turn can be used to turn on various control elements like, fans,
pumps, motors, etc.
Based on the degree of meeting or exceeding the established limits, a precise
analog output signal can be generated. This signal can be used to provide a
complete closed loop control patch providing continuous control of a process.
A DAQ system does not need to stop with just an analog-to-digital and a
digital-to-analog function. More complex systems can and do included timers,
abundant digital input and digital output control lines, signal conditioning
and multiplexing.
